Show this weekend

by Bill Rosenblum

This weekend is the annual Colorado Springs Coin Show which will be held on Friday, Saturday and Sunday at the Phil Long Expo center in the northern part of the city.

Traditionally many dealers at this show have material for military collectors. Furthermore, many collectors from both sessions of the summer seminar will likely be present.

Championship Question Corner

Question 204. Difficulty 1. What contractor in the United States printed supplemental francs?

Previous Question: Question 204. Difficulty 1. What contractor printed supplemental francs?

Answers and comments: Bill Myers correctly answered Forbes Lithograph.
